Dienstag, 28. April 2009
OpenWrt
knirps, 21:43h
Am Sonntag habe ich OpenWrt auf dem Linksys-WRT54GL installiert.
Die Installation lief ohne Probleme, die Grundeinstellungen ließen sich auch ohne Probleme tätigen. Ein kleines Problem ergab sich, als ich neue Pakete installieren wollte: Der Paketmanager war nicht installiert. So schien es. Am Ende lag es daran, dass jetzt ein anderer Paketmanager verwendet wird. Vorher hieß er ipkg, jetzt heißt er opkg. Die Befehlssyntax ist gleich, also war es im Endeffekt egal.
Alles wichtige Läuft jetzt, nur bei meiner alten Kiste, die ich per Cronjob und WakeOnLAN vom Router aus aufwecken wollte, funktioniert WoL nicht mehr. Ist aber nicht des Routers Schuld.
So far... Open Source for the win!
Die Installation lief ohne Probleme, die Grundeinstellungen ließen sich auch ohne Probleme tätigen. Ein kleines Problem ergab sich, als ich neue Pakete installieren wollte: Der Paketmanager war nicht installiert. So schien es. Am Ende lag es daran, dass jetzt ein anderer Paketmanager verwendet wird. Vorher hieß er ipkg, jetzt heißt er opkg. Die Befehlssyntax ist gleich, also war es im Endeffekt egal.
Alles wichtige Läuft jetzt, nur bei meiner alten Kiste, die ich per Cronjob und WakeOnLAN vom Router aus aufwecken wollte, funktioniert WoL nicht mehr. Ist aber nicht des Routers Schuld.
So far... Open Source for the win!
... link (0 Kommentare) ... comment
Donnerstag, 16. April 2009
Direct Rendering: yes
knirps, 01:48h
Ich fasse es nicht! Ich habe auf meinem Laptop endlich die Möglichkeit, direct rendering zu nutzen.
Seit letztem Sommer habe ich diese Kiste nun, und heute habe ich, im Zuge eines Kernelupdates (auf 2.6.29) und eines nicht funktionierenden Ebuilds die neueste Treiberversion des fglrx-Treibers heruntergeladen und manuell installiert. Jetzt funktioniert direct rendering. Dummerweise flackern 3D-Anwendungen bei Compiz immer noch. Naja, vielleicht wird ihnen das auch irgendwann ausgetrieben...
Seit letztem Sommer habe ich diese Kiste nun, und heute habe ich, im Zuge eines Kernelupdates (auf 2.6.29) und eines nicht funktionierenden Ebuilds die neueste Treiberversion des fglrx-Treibers heruntergeladen und manuell installiert. Jetzt funktioniert direct rendering. Dummerweise flackern 3D-Anwendungen bei Compiz immer noch. Naja, vielleicht wird ihnen das auch irgendwann ausgetrieben...
... link (0 Kommentare) ... comment
Donnerstag, 19. März 2009
emerge Mono-2.2-r3 failed
knirps, 13:48h
Neulich auf meiner alten x86er-Kiste: Mono lässt sich nicht updaten, emerge bricht jedesmal mit einer nichtssagenden die-Message ab.
Weitere Versuche ergaben: auch die Vorversion, die ja schon installiert war, lies sich nicht neu kompilieren.
Lösung:
echo "=dev-lang/mono-2.2-r3" >> /etc/portage/package.mask
Dann die Updates für alle anderen Sachen aufgespielt, emerge --depclean und revdep-rebuild laufen lassen. So war der Rest des Systems auf dem neuesten Stand.
Dann einfach mono wieder aus package.mask herausnehmen, es noch einmal probieren - es geht.
Endlich.
Weitere Versuche ergaben: auch die Vorversion, die ja schon installiert war, lies sich nicht neu kompilieren.
Lösung:
echo "=dev-lang/mono-2.2-r3" >> /etc/portage/package.mask
Dann die Updates für alle anderen Sachen aufgespielt, emerge --depclean und revdep-rebuild laufen lassen. So war der Rest des Systems auf dem neuesten Stand.
Dann einfach mono wieder aus package.mask herausnehmen, es noch einmal probieren - es geht.
Endlich.
... link (0 Kommentare) ... comment
Freitag, 13. Februar 2009
endlich native WLAN-Treiber
knirps, 03:30h
Die Odyssey hat ein Ende. Nach langem Benutzen von ndiswrapper, um meine Wlankarte Atheros AR5006 mit einem Windowstreiber zu betreiben, läuft sie jetzt endlich nativ unter Linux.
Heute im Labor habe ich es noch mit madwifi versucht - vergeblich - dadurch habe ich dann den NE nicht mehr erwischt und durfte eine halbde Stunde lang zu Fuß nach Hause laufen - aber jetzt habe ich immerhin die Lösung meines Problems. Wie in der gentoo-wiki steht, kann man den ath5k Treiber im Kernel dazu verwenden, die Karte zu betreiben. Es funktioniert übrigens bis jetzt tadellos, allerdings steht auf der Seite der Entwickler, er würde in "noisy environments" schlechter laufen als madwifi und ndiswrapper. In meiner Unwissenheit nehme ich einfach mal an, das bedeutet, dass er Probleme bekommt, wenn viele Netze auf einmal senden. Da muss ich mich noch informieren. Naja, ndiswrapper bleibt erst noch einmal drauf, als Notrettung, ich werde es aber hoffentlich nicht brauchen.
Gute Nacht.
Heute im Labor habe ich es noch mit madwifi versucht - vergeblich - dadurch habe ich dann den NE nicht mehr erwischt und durfte eine halbde Stunde lang zu Fuß nach Hause laufen - aber jetzt habe ich immerhin die Lösung meines Problems. Wie in der gentoo-wiki steht, kann man den ath5k Treiber im Kernel dazu verwenden, die Karte zu betreiben. Es funktioniert übrigens bis jetzt tadellos, allerdings steht auf der Seite der Entwickler, er würde in "noisy environments" schlechter laufen als madwifi und ndiswrapper. In meiner Unwissenheit nehme ich einfach mal an, das bedeutet, dass er Probleme bekommt, wenn viele Netze auf einmal senden. Da muss ich mich noch informieren. Naja, ndiswrapper bleibt erst noch einmal drauf, als Notrettung, ich werde es aber hoffentlich nicht brauchen.
Gute Nacht.
... link (0 Kommentare) ... comment
Dienstag, 6. Januar 2009
Alsa und ein Kopfhörer am Laptop
knirps, 00:27h
Bis vor kurzem (bis gerade eben) hatte ich an meinem Laptop das Problem, dass sich meine Boxen nicht ausgeschaltet haben. Gerade eben habe ich das Problem gelöst.
Wenn ich jetzt auf die schnelle wieder die Seite finden würde, auf der die Lösung stand, würde ich das hier auch posten. Jetzt muss ich aber ins Bett. Also gibt es den Link morgen. Oder gestern. Oder vielleicht auch nicht.
Gute Nacht.
Edit: naja, ich finde die Seite nicht wieder, aber hier ist eine ähnliche Beschreibung.
Mit gentoo funktioniert das auf meinem MSI-Notebook ganz gut.
Wenn ich jetzt auf die schnelle wieder die Seite finden würde, auf der die Lösung stand, würde ich das hier auch posten. Jetzt muss ich aber ins Bett. Also gibt es den Link morgen. Oder gestern. Oder vielleicht auch nicht.
Gute Nacht.
Edit: naja, ich finde die Seite nicht wieder, aber hier ist eine ähnliche Beschreibung.
Mit gentoo funktioniert das auf meinem MSI-Notebook ganz gut.
... link (0 Kommentare) ... comment
Donnerstag, 21. August 2008
compiz-fusion
knirps, 18:57h
Uff... Nach Stunde der Quälerei läuft compiz-fusion jetzt endlich einigermaßen reibungslos auf dem Laptop. Zuerst gab es große Probleme mit dem Ati-Treiber, jetzt gibt es nur noch kleine Probleme mit selbigem. Compiz, ein Windowmanager mit 3D-Effekten läuft absolut flüssig, kein Ruckeln. Jetzt habe ich jede Menge sinnvolle (und noch mehr sinnlose) Effekte für meine Grafische Oberfläche. Leider musste diesem WM mein bisheriger Favorit fluxbox weichen, der durchaus einige Funktionen hatte, die compiz nicht hat. Diese habe ich dann durch die Installation des Xfce4 Desktop-Environments allerdings wiederbekommen.
Ich kann garnicht aufhören, diesen Würfel zu drehen...
Ich kann garnicht aufhören, diesen Würfel zu drehen...
... link (0 Kommentare) ... comment
Dienstag, 12. August 2008
emerge --unmerge "sys-devel/gcc-4.1.2"
knirps, 17:26h
Oben genanntes sollte man nicht tun, es sei denn, man hat noch einen zweiten Compiler installiert, und weiß auch, wie man diesen im Bedarfsfall als Standardcompiler einrichtet. Nachdem ich mir so richtig das System auf meinem Laptop zerschossen habe, kompiliert er jetzt nach der Installation eines vorkompilierten gcc diverse Bibliotheken.
Und an allem ist natürlich nur dieser ?!)/&/! Drang Schuld, ein Java-Plugin für den Firefox haben zu wollen. Auf einer 64bit-Plattform naturgemäß schwierig, da die proprietären Anbieter keine 64-Bit plugins für den Firefox liefern, bzw. diese Löcher haben, so groß wie der Bodensee, und die Emulatoren auch irgendwie nicht wollen, habe ich auf ein OpenSource-Projekt zurückgreifen müssen. Problem: Dieses JDK ist nicht im portage.
Also ein Overlay installiert.
Ach ja, IcedTea (das JDK) braucht noch zusätzliche Bibliotheken.
Also diese installiert... Moment
Erst einmal unmasken...
aber jetzt installieren
nein, die gcc braucht ne neuere Version <---DA IST ES
also unmasken
und installieren?
nein, die glibc braucht auch ne neuere Version...
(...)
Installieren... glibc und gcc sind verdammt groß...
Und dann sollte eigentlich IcedTea installiert werden... ging aber nicht...
ein bisschen rumgebastelt...
mit Erfolg, jetzt ließ sich zwar IcedTea immer noch nicht installieren...
...dafür aber auch nichts anderes mehr.
nicht mal die gcc
und irgendwie fehlten den Programmen die Zugriffe auf die gcc-libs...
naja, momentan ist der Laptop auf dem Weg zur Besserung, und ich habe wieder was gelernt, nämlich wie ich es hätte richtig machen müssen.
Naja, Linux wurde nicht dazu gemacht, um den Benutzer daran zu hindern, dumme Sachen zu tun. Das würde ihn nämlich auch daran hindern, kluge Sachen zu tun.
Und an allem ist natürlich nur dieser ?!)/&/! Drang Schuld, ein Java-Plugin für den Firefox haben zu wollen. Auf einer 64bit-Plattform naturgemäß schwierig, da die proprietären Anbieter keine 64-Bit plugins für den Firefox liefern, bzw. diese Löcher haben, so groß wie der Bodensee, und die Emulatoren auch irgendwie nicht wollen, habe ich auf ein OpenSource-Projekt zurückgreifen müssen. Problem: Dieses JDK ist nicht im portage.
Also ein Overlay installiert.
Ach ja, IcedTea (das JDK) braucht noch zusätzliche Bibliotheken.
Also diese installiert... Moment
Erst einmal unmasken...
aber jetzt installieren
nein, die gcc braucht ne neuere Version <---DA IST ES
also unmasken
und installieren?
nein, die glibc braucht auch ne neuere Version...
(...)
Installieren... glibc und gcc sind verdammt groß...
Und dann sollte eigentlich IcedTea installiert werden... ging aber nicht...
ein bisschen rumgebastelt...
mit Erfolg, jetzt ließ sich zwar IcedTea immer noch nicht installieren...
...dafür aber auch nichts anderes mehr.
nicht mal die gcc
und irgendwie fehlten den Programmen die Zugriffe auf die gcc-libs...
naja, momentan ist der Laptop auf dem Weg zur Besserung, und ich habe wieder was gelernt, nämlich wie ich es hätte richtig machen müssen.
Naja, Linux wurde nicht dazu gemacht, um den Benutzer daran zu hindern, dumme Sachen zu tun. Das würde ihn nämlich auch daran hindern, kluge Sachen zu tun.
... link (0 Kommentare) ... comment
Montag, 11. August 2008
fbsplash
knirps, 14:23h
Dem Howto auf der gentoo Linux-Wiki folgend habe ich heute einen fbsplash-Screen auf meinem Laptop eingerichtet. Das Dingsbums also, dass beim booten die Textausgabe in den Hintergrund drückt und stattdessen ein Bild und einen Fortschrittsbalken anzeigt.
Warum habe ich das getan? Ich bin doch bisher immer prima so ausgekommen, oder?
Nunja, wenn man einen Laptop hat, und diesen an verschiedene Stellen mitnimmt, dann bekommt man, wenn der Computer beim booten sinnvollerweise mitteilt, was er gerade macht, immer den Kommentar: "Was ist denn das für ein uralter Computer?"
Das ist nun wirklich nicht gerechtfertigt, also habe ich jetzt einen splashscreen installiert, der die interessanten Seiten des Bootvorgangs übertüncht, nur damit ich nicht jedes Mal erklären muss, das Linux ein deutlich moderneres OS ist als Windows...
Warum habe ich das getan? Ich bin doch bisher immer prima so ausgekommen, oder?
Nunja, wenn man einen Laptop hat, und diesen an verschiedene Stellen mitnimmt, dann bekommt man, wenn der Computer beim booten sinnvollerweise mitteilt, was er gerade macht, immer den Kommentar: "Was ist denn das für ein uralter Computer?"
Das ist nun wirklich nicht gerechtfertigt, also habe ich jetzt einen splashscreen installiert, der die interessanten Seiten des Bootvorgangs übertüncht, nur damit ich nicht jedes Mal erklären muss, das Linux ein deutlich moderneres OS ist als Windows...
... link (0 Kommentare) ... comment
Dienstag, 26. Februar 2008
portage rulez
knirps, 20:08h
So... ich habe noch ein kleines Paket gefunden, das die Benutzung von Portage, dem gentoo-Paketmanager komfortabler macht. Dieses Programm heißt eix, und es legt einen Index mit den verfügbaren Paketen an. Diese können dann deutlich schneller durchsucht werden.
... link (0 Kommentare) ... comment
Sonntag, 24. Februar 2008
Und da wären wir...
knirps, 01:50h
So... Linux läuft auf der neuen Kiste, um die Feineinstellung werde ich mich noch kümmern müssen, aber nicht mehr in dieser Nacht.
Auf der alten Kiste hingegen ist portage jetzt schon ziemlich weit mit dem emergen von banshee, ich bin mal gespannt.
Was mir übrigens aufgefallen ist: Wenn ich mal wieder eine der Phasen habe, in denen ich mit der Welt überhaupt nicht klar komme (von denen habe ich seit ziemlich genau einem Jahr erstaunlich viele), dann setze ich mich vor einen Computer, und arbeite an einem Problem, bis alles funktioniert oder eben nicht.
Auf der alten Kiste hingegen ist portage jetzt schon ziemlich weit mit dem emergen von banshee, ich bin mal gespannt.
Was mir übrigens aufgefallen ist: Wenn ich mal wieder eine der Phasen habe, in denen ich mit der Welt überhaupt nicht klar komme (von denen habe ich seit ziemlich genau einem Jahr erstaunlich viele), dann setze ich mich vor einen Computer, und arbeite an einem Problem, bis alles funktioniert oder eben nicht.
... link (0 Kommentare) ... comment
... nächste Seite